Bitcoin is often described as the world’s best store of value, yet when holders need capital, they usually face the same familiar choices: sell their BTC, wrap it into another asset, bridge it to another blockchain, or hand it over to a custodian. Every option requires compromising one of Bitcoin’s core principles.
Looking for an alternative, I came across Trustless Bitcoin Vaults (TBV) from @BabylonLabs_io
What caught my attention was that TBV isn’t designed to be “just another lending protocol.” Its core idea is much more ambitious: enabling native Bitcoin to become productive collateral without wrapping it, bridging it, or relying on centralized custodians. Instead of forcing Bitcoin to adapt to DeFi, TBV aims to build infrastructure where DeFi can work directly with Bitcoin itself.
The first integration with Aave v4 is simply the initial demonstration of that vision. Through TBV, native BTC can unlock liquidity and support borrowing assets such as USDC or USDT while preserving the properties that make Bitcoin unique.
Whether Trustless Bitcoin Vaults become the foundation of BTCFi remains to be seen. But for the first time in a long while, I feel the conversation is no longer about changing Bitcoin to fit DeFi.
It’s about building a financial system that finally fits Bitcoin. #baby $BABY $BTC $BANK

For years, DeFi has treated TVL as the ultimate metric.
But what if capital efficiency matters more?
BNB Chain processes roughly $2.7 billion in DEX volume each day, equivalent to nearly 1trillion on an annualized basis. Most of that flow is still routed through passive AMMs. PancakeSwap alone holds around $2.2 billion in TVL while facilitating approximately $1.5 billion in daily volume, illustrating the capital intensity of current liquidity models.
GeniusFi is built around a different premise: active quoting can deliver more capital-efficient execution than passive liquidity pools. Over the past 18–24 months on Solana, Prop AMMs have become dominant venues for short-tail order flow by consistently quoting tighter spreads with significantly less capital than traditional AMMs. One structural reason is that updating quotes on Solana is far cheaper than executing swaps, allowing market makers to refresh prices before stale quotes are exposed to adverse selection.
BEP-668 aims to change that. The proposal introduces a relay-sidecar pre-confirmation system with signed inclusion lists that prioritize quote updates at the top of the block. In theory, this gives market makers stronger guarantees around quote freshness, reducing the need for defensive spread widening and improving execution quality for traders.
What differentiates GeniusFi from most Prop AMM designs is its unified inventory model. Rather than fragmenting liquidity across isolated trading pairs, a shared inventory can service multiple markets simultaneously while enabling automatic cross-pair routing. In principle, this allows the same capital base to support deeper liquidity and lower price impact, particularly for larger trades.
Under this framework, TVL becomes a less informative measure of market quality. The more relevant question is how efficiently liquidity is deployed when trades occur. GeniusFi’s thesis is that BNB Chain’s scale and trading activity make it a compelling environment to test that model. $GENIUS #geniusfi @GeniusOfficial

HTTP 402 has been sitting unused for 28 years. OpenLedger just activated it. x402 is the part of OpenLedger most people scroll past. I think it’s the most important thing they’ve built. HTTP 402 — “Payment Required” — has existed since 1998. written into the original HTTP spec as a placeholder for future micropayment systems. never implemented. sat dormant for 28 years because there was no programmable money layer to make it work. OpenLedger open-sourced x402 in February 2026 and finally turned it on. normally when an AI model needs to pay for data or a service, there’s a human somewhere in the loop. an API key gets provisioned. an invoice gets generated. someone approves the payment. the whole thing is slow and built for humans, not machines. x402 removes that entirely. an AI model reads a 402 response, negotiates price encoded in the HTTP header, pays via the OpenLedger network, and royalties flow back to the original data contributors — inside a single request-response cycle. the transaction settles before the connection closes. no approval. no invoice. no intermediary. what separates this from “crypto payments for AI” is the attribution layer underneath. the payment isn’t just going to whoever hosts the model. it’s being split and routed to the specific contributors whose data influenced the specific output being paid for. Proof of Attribution calculates the split. x402 executes it. OPEN token flows through both. I keep coming back to what this means at the margins. if a specialized AI model can autonomously license data, pay for inference, and compensate contributors without touching a human workflow — the cost and complexity of building niche AI products drops significantly. a solo developer with a good dataset and a fine-tuned LoRA adapter can deploy something that pays for itself. the protocol is live and open-sourced. developers can build on it today. whether anyone does — at scale — is the only question that matters now
